“Snooker” by Peter Arnold is a comprehensive exploration of the sport, published by Deans International in 1984. This edition consists of 96 pages and is presented in English. The book delves into the intricacies of snooker, offering insights into its rules, techniques, and strategies, making it a valuable resource for both beginners and seasoned players.

Readers will find detailed discussions on various aspects of the game, including the skills required to excel in snooker and the importance of practice and precision. The book covers essential topics related to sports and individual sports, specifically focusing on billiards and pool. With its informative content, “Snooker” serves as a guide for those looking to enhance their understanding and performance in this popular cue sport.
